Dive into an advanced lecture on transport phenomena in quantum spin chains, presented by Marko Znidaric at the BSS Physics School 2023. Explore the intricate dynamics of quantum systems as the speaker delves deeper into the topic, building upon previous discussions. Gain insights into the latest research and theoretical developments in this fascinating area of quantum physics. Enhance your understanding of quantum transport mechanisms, their implications for quantum information processing, and potential applications in quantum technologies. Suitable for graduate students and researchers in physics, this comprehensive talk offers a rigorous examination of the subject matter over the course of 1 hour and 37 minutes.
